Order Entry
Switzerland
ContactUsLinkComponent
Recombinant Human IL-16 (129 a.a.) 1 * 100 µG
Catalog # PEPR200-16-100UG
Supplier:  PeproTech, Inc.
Recombinant Human IL-16 (129 a.a.) 1 * 100 µG
Catalog # PEPR200-16-100UG
Supplier:  PeproTech, Inc.
Frequently Bought Together